Cost of Living: Centennial, CO vs Hialeah, FL

Housing

The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.

Metric Centennial Hialeah
Housing Index 121.1 110.9
Median Home Price $539,000 $339,000
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) $2279 $2141
Average Rent (2 BR House) $2478 $2327

Housing Comparison: Centennial vs Hialeah

  • In Centennial, the median home price is higher at $539,000, while in Hialeah it is $339,000.
  • Renting a two-bedroom apartment costs more in Centennial at $2,279 than in Hialeah at $2,141.

Utilities

The cost of utilities such as electricity, natural gas, and other services can significantly impact the overall cost of living.

Metric Centennial Hialeah
Electricity Price $15.21 $13.89
Natural Gas Price $11.3 $26.13
Other Utilities $246 $243

Utilities Comparison: Centennial vs Hialeah

  • Electricity costs are higher in Centennial at $15.21 per kWh, compared to $13.89 in Hialeah.
  • Hialeah experiences higher natural gas costs at $26.13 per unit, with costs at $11.3 in Centennial.
  • Other utility costs are higher in Centennial at an average of $246, compared to Hialeah with $243.
